Image quality phaser 3435 5/08 3-5 iq 2 abnormal image printing and defective roller if abnormal image prints periodically, check the parts shown below. Figure 1 no roller abnormal image period kind of abnormal image 1 opc drum 75.5mm white spot, block spot 2 charge roller 37.7mm black spot 3 supply...

Page 203
General procedures and information phaser 3435 5/08 6-17 temperature-interception device (thermostat) • thermostat type: non-contact type thermostat • control temperature: 170 degrees c +/-5 degrees c • thermostat-roller gap: 1.6 +/-0.2mm temperature detecting sensor (thermistor) • thermistor type: ...

Page 215
General procedures and information phaser 3435 5/08 6-29 table 4: • transfer the charging voltage, developing voltage and the transfer voltage are controlled by pwm (pulse width modulation). The each output voltage is changeable due to the pwm duty. The transfer voltage admitted when the paper passe...
